FRANK BENCH

Frank G. “Jerry” Bench, 80, of Bridgeport, OH, died Thursday, August 29, 2019, at Forest Hills Care Center, in St. Clairsville, surrounded by his loving family.

He was born July 4, 1939, in Wheeling, WV, a son of the late Frank and Louise (Marx) Bench.

He was a retired employee of Wheeling-Pittsburgh Steel’s Yorkville Plant with 39 years of service; he was also a former employee of Wilson Funeral Home, a member of the First Presbyterian Church, St Clairsville, where he served as a deacon. Jerry was a member of the Grand Lodge F&AM of Ohio Weyer Lodge 541 in Centerville, Osiris Shrine of Wheeling, Grand Council Royal and Select Masons of Ohio, the Grand Chapter of Royal Arch Masons of Ohio, Hope Commandry 26 Knights Templar of Bridgeport, Bellaire Chapter 107 Royal Arch Masons, Secret Vault of Bellaire Council 87, all of these for over 50 years. He also was a graduate of St. Clairsville High School, Class of 1957.

In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his sister, Shirley Bench; and brother-in-law, Christ Pashalis.

Survived are his loving wife of 50 years, Nettie (Muklewicz) Bench; a son, Kevin (Rebbeca) Bench of Bridgeport; two loving grandchildren, Emily and Matthew Bench; and a sister-in-law, Brenda Pashalis of Bridgeport.
